Output 3859067b64ccc96370d82dd2f1b83e42401cefaffe2d0e9a42e5742d7c539d69:1

value
1925777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a1fd3e023edfeff45df8ae7ff8122d8c5324ad OP_EQUAL
address
3HyYFu4VhwxaAnY61H1JaM3mccrnaBxTGj
transaction
3859067b64ccc96370d82dd2f1b83e42401cefaffe2d0e9a42e5742d7c539d69
confirmations
3180
spent
true